How
can professional temporary staff make your life easier?
Today's competitive and
changing business environment requires a flexible workforce to cope
with additional demands. Rather than stretching the resources of
permanent employees and decreasing productivity, why not consider
using temporary staff as an alternative?
For many managers, the
convenience of using temporary staff is very appealing. For many
others however, the benefits of using temporary staff are yet to be
discovered. How can this untapped resource benefit you and your team?
Here are some ways in which temporary staff can add value to your team
and make life easier for you.
- Temporary staff are
available at short notice. Agencies have a specialised and
extensive database of temporary employees who are available to
fill a variety of roles when needed. This helps to eliminate the
delay associated with advertising, interviewing and sourcing
people. All you need to do is make one phone call to your
specialised temporary Recruitment Consultant.
- Temporary staff are
flexible. They have the ability to fill a variety of roles in a
variety of industries. They can help out in a number of different
departments and assist where they are most needed.
- Having worked at a number
of different organisations, temporary employees bring with them
fresh ideas and new ways of doing things, making themselves a
valuable addition to your team.
- As temporary employees are
just that - temporary - you have the flexibility to hire, extend
and terminate assignments according to your workload needs.
- Temporary staff are
convenient employees as they decrease head count. They are not
actually your employees; temporary staff are employed by the
agency, which means the agency will cover employee costs included
wages, payroll tax, superannuation and workers compensation, etc.
All you need to do is pay the one hourly rate that includes all
on-costs. This ultimately means less paper work, responsibility
and hassle for you and your staff, leaving you to concentrate on
your core business.
- Even when looking for
permanent staff, think about a "temporary to permanent"
situation. This enables you to trial your new employee before
committing to putting them on permanently. It also gives your new
recruit a chance to see if they are happy with their new position.
So if you discover that things are not working out as planned, you
can terminate the arrangement and start looking again.

ROY MORGAN PREDICTS CONFIDENCE IN
JOB SECURITY
In 2003, Australians are more confident
in the security of their jobs and the opportunities to find new
employment in comparison to last year, according to a Roy Morgan
International Gallup Survey on the year ahead. Over three-quarters of
Australians feel confident that their present job is safe (up 4% from
last year), with 20% saying there is a chance of unemployment and 1%
unable to say. Even if they were to become unemployed, 66% of
Australians (up 12%) think that they will keep their job in 2003, with
67% (up 9%) confident that if they lose their job, they could find
work quickly.
